**Step 7 — Replica lag alarm check.** Before sealing the signing keys for Vantrell's quarterly ceremony, confirm the read-replica lag alarm on the Orbiton cluster is green. If lag exceeds 30 seconds, pause the ceremony and page the data platform rotation. New contractors: do not skip this; a lagging replica can serve stale key-state reads during attestation. Once the alarm shows green, unlock the escrow vault using the passphrase below.

vault phrase of yahif-hahaf = istael-gorir-fenwyn-belael-novys-novok-juldor

Runbook: Scanline barcode bridge

If warehouse scans stop flowing into Cartwheel, it's almost always the bridge service on the Dunmore floor box wedging after a USB hiccup. Bounce the service first — nine times out of ten that fixes it. If not, check the queue depth before escalating. When restarting, make sure the bridge comes up with these settings.

deployment values, yafop-bajef:
[gilok]
team = ulaius
access_code = ac_423664
host = gilok.sivrelhq.corp
port = 9200
owner = pelius.istax
peer = eliok.torvasoft.internal

**Ticket PARITY-412: Kestrel SDK catch-up**

Quick one for the weekly sync: the Kestrel-Go SDK is still missing batched uploads and retry hints that Kestrel-JS shipped two releases ago. Partner teams keep asking. Plan is to land both behind a flag this sprint and cut a minor release. Needs a sign-off from the owner named below.

account owner for bajef-badup: Drueth Kelath Pelael Holwyn

Quillbase API — Environments

The public REST API runs in three environments: sandbox, staging, and production. Pagination defaults differ per environment to keep sandbox responses small. Cursor-based pagination is enforced everywhere; offset mode was retired in release 7. Before promoting a build, confirm the environment-specific pagination settings match this page. The current production values are as follows.

deployment values, yadug-bawif:
[framir]
team = pelox
access_code = ac_a38ab2
owner = tamion.julael
host = framir.tolvaqlabs.test
port = 11211
peer = tammir.zemvargrid.local
salt = 2215ef03
pin = 1541